Anna's x Costa's Hummingbird (hybrid) (Calypte anna x costae) (1)
- Reported Oct 29, 2025 07:52 by John Callender
- Santa Monica Creek, Santa Barbara, California
- Map: http://maps.google.com/?ie=UTF8&t=p&z=13&<q...>,-119.5278168&<ll...>,-119.5278168 - Checklist: https://ebird.org/checklist/S281925264 - Media: 4 Photos
- Comments: "Seen near (34.410461,-119.526823). Very likely the returning Costa's x Anna's hybrid that has wintered in this location the last two years. Flared, purple gorget. Heard vocalizing with a relatively low-volume version of an Anna's Hummingbird song. See additional photos and discussion in this checklist from October 28, 2024, including remarks by Sheri Williamson: https://ebird.org/checklist/S200612332"
Mountain Bluebird (Sialia currucoides) (1)
- Reported Oct 26, 2025 12:54 by Bob Hough
- Santa Cruz Island--Cavern Point, Santa Barbara, California
- Map: http://maps.google.com/?ie=UTF8&t=p&z=13&<q...>,-119.5632005&<ll...>,-119.5632005 - Checklist: https://ebird.org/checklist/S281945960 - Comments: "Female bird found just by the viewpoint of Cavern Point, frequenting the rock outcroppings. Dull bluebird, "rufous" adult female, muted teardrop eye outline, all dark bill, hints of sky blue in wing coverts and tail when perched, seen in flight with flash of sky blue in lower body. Photos"

Clay-colored Sparrow (Spizella pallida) (1)
- Reported Oct 26, 2025 10:30 by Bob Hough
- Santa Cruz Island--Scorpion Canyon Campgrounds, Santa Barbara, California
- Map: http://maps.google.com/?ie=UTF8&t=p&z=13&<q...>,-119.5645389&<ll...>,-119.5645389 - Checklist: https://ebird.org/checklist/S281943573 - Media: 7 Photos
- Comments: "In feeding flock of CHSP, DEJU and WCSP along southwest side of upper campground. Unique amongst Spizellas present with buffy features, clean white malar "mustache" and all gray nape. Potentially continuing individual. Photos"
